A RoleplayingGame worldbook for Creator/SteveJacksonGames' popular TabletopGame/{{GURPS}} system, ''Tales of the Solar Patrol'' is set in the future of the 21st Century, as it was imagined by of pulp writers during the Golden Age Of Science Fiction. Venus is swampy, Mars has canals, and the Overlord of the Jupiter rules its moons with a literal iron fist. RaygunGothic and RuleOfCool, in other words, are the order of the day.
